6-Day Goa Itinerary: Sun, Sand, and Serenity

Friday, December 22: Arrival and Beach Delights

Start your Goa adventure by checking into your hotel and refreshing yourselves after your journey. Kick off your morning by heading to Calangute Beach, known for its golden sands and lively atmosphere. Take a dip in the Arabian Sea and soak up the sun.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ant markets and shops near Baga Beach, where you can find unique handicrafts and souvenirs. As the evening sets in, enjoy a beachfront dinner at one of the many delicious seafood shacks along the coast.

Saturday, December 23: Historic Charm and Heritage Sites

Immerse yourself in Goa's rich history and culture today. Begin your day with a visit to the UNESCO World Heritage Site, Bom Jesus Basilica. Marvel at the stunning Baroque architecture and pay respects to the preserved remains of St. Francis Xavier. In the afternoon, explore the magnificent Fort Aguada, built in the 17th century, offering breathtaking views of the Arabian Sea. As the sun sets, stroll through the vibrant Latin Quarter of Fontainhas, admiring the colorful Portuguese colonial houses and quaint cafes.

Sunday, December 24: Spice Plantations and Nature's Beauty

Discover Goa's natural wonders and indulge in its flavors today. Begin your day with a tour of a spice plantation where you can learn about various spices and try local delicacies. Afterward, visit the enchanting Dudhsagar Falls, one of India's tallest waterfalls, surrounded by lush greenery. Enjoy a swim in the refreshing pool beneath the falls. In the late afternoon, head to Miramar Beach for a leisurely walk along its serene shores, watching the sunset paint the sky in vibrant colors.

Monday, December 25: Old Goa and Sunset Cruise

Explore the colonial heritage of Goa and end your day with a memorable sunset cruise. Start your morning by visiting the Se Cathedral, one of Asia's largest churches. Admire the impressive Portuguese architecture and visit the nearby Church of St. Francis of Assisi. In the afternoon, discover the sprawling ruins of the Church of St. Augustine and explore the Archaeological Museum of Goa. As the evening approaches, embark on a relaxing cruise along the Mandovi River, enjoying live music, dance performances, and a picturesque sunset.

Tuesday, December 26: Adventure and Watersports

Indulge in thrilling activities and exhilarating water sports today. Start your morning with an exciting trek to the stunning South Goa viewpoint, offering panoramic vistas of the coastline. In the afternoon, head to Palolem Beach, known for its clear waters and palm-fringed shores. Try your hand at kayaking, paddleboarding, or jet skiing. You can also take a boat trip to Butterfly Beach, a hidden gem surrounded by pristine nature. Enjoy a tranquil evening at Palolem Beach, savoring delicious seafood and watching the stars.

Wednesday, December 27: Serene Churches and Farewell

Spend your last day in Goa visiting serene churches and bidding farewell to this tropical paradise. Begin your morning at the Chapel of Our Lady of the Mount, offering breathtaking views of Old Goa. Explore the Church of Our Lady of Immaculate Conception, known for its pristine white façade. In the afternoon, visit the Mae De Deus Church, adorned with stunning stained glass windows. As the sun sets on your Goa adventure, take a leisurely walk along the picturesque Dona Paula Beach, relishing the memories created during your stay.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While in Goa, don't miss out on visiting the lesser-known gems and local hotspots. Head to the peaceful Divar Island, just a short ferry ride away, to experience the tranquility of Goan village life and explore its ancient temples. If you're a nature lover, visit the Bondla Wildlife Sanctuary, known for its diverse wildlife and lush greenery. For a taste of authentic Goan cuisine, visit a local spice plantation and indulge in traditional dishes like Goan fish curry and Bebinca, a delicious Goan dessert.
